Output d15b3cc255e0a7f417dc0d59e9bcb4e7a9afa2f3fe8cd6b9aec07bbf871cda68:0

value
987309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54cc7698f19325096efc7b5761d7a9ecdba693d1 OP_EQUAL
address
39RPd1oXnGkTJ2JbAoEVnmVGnRcQg6cg7T
transaction
d15b3cc255e0a7f417dc0d59e9bcb4e7a9afa2f3fe8cd6b9aec07bbf871cda68
confirmations
279876
spent
true